IPhone 7 Promotion last Sept.

I signed up for the promotion in 9/16. I traded my paid for, mint condition iPhone 6 for a iPhone 7 and a credit of up to $650 over the life of the att next contract.

To this day, I have not received a single credit on my account! I have spoken live to 3 customer service reps, went to the att store that I signed up at and "chatted" with 2 different customer service agents....NOTHING!

My first call after not receiving a credit on my account for the next billing cycle, I was told for the first time that it would take 2-3 billing cycles before the credit would show.

The next call, a month later, I was told, "you need to be patient, that's all I can do".

The third call, "you will receive a lump credit on your next bill for all of the previous months."

The store visit? They confirmed all of my account info and verified I was part of the promotion. They then said I needed to call "customer service" and they could apply the credits immediately and that this promotion has had problems.

The two chat sessions last Wednesday? The first lasted nearly an hour with a guy named "Breyven". He promised to "bump this to a supervisor" and that it would be "resolved". Due to the length of the session, I had to end it. But I gave him contact info, he said "a supervisor will contact you by tomorrow, at the latest". I have not received a call or email yet.

The last chat was very productive. Especially when she told me that there were no notes from my previous chat session attached to my account!!! UNBELIEVABLE!!!

We continued and though I expressed my frustration, she was very professional and polite. She gave me a case number and promised resolution by Feb 3. We will see....I'm not holding my breath.

I'm not sure if ended early is the right wording, for the first few weeks (see below) it just said "limited time" but they had an end date of 9/30 in PR, so many assumed it was later. At some point (between the 17th and the 24th) the 25th showed up as an end date on https://www.att.com/esupport/article.html#!/wireless/KM1180261

 

Screen Shot 2017-02-02 at 5.30.01 PM.pngNo end date.

From the "press release" http://about.att.com/newsroom/iphone_7_pricing.html

For a limited time, customers can also trade in an iPhone 6, iPhone 6 Plus, iPhone 6S, or iPhone 6S Plus that’s in good working condition and they can get an iPhone 7 32 GB free after $650 in monthly bill credits when they buy it on AT&T Next or AT&T Next Every Year with eligible service.

The promotion was pulled early. It was pulled on the 25th. It only went on til the 30th in Puerto Rico. If you look back on some old posts from around that time, there were a lot of upset people because they waited until the last minute and the promotion ended when they reached the limit of the phones sold. It had to be purchased on or prior to the 25th.
